The NW Ridge of Sir Donald is still very snowy on the N side of the ridge.
The hot weather will help it along, but it may take a while yet before it
is in perfect climbing condition. Even the approach to the col is still
significantly snow covered.
The Goodsirs appear to be very out of condition....maybe August at the rate
we are going.
Storm Mountain looked drier than anything else we looked at today.
